Output 5824bc7e50bb304f913fca6e28acf6073c87f05b53cd261d7f9ca0d5bba77e78:0

value
523463860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d76108d57d37b4fb0c7f076445badc3a24ce9e6 OP_EQUALVERIFY OP_CHECKSIG
address
184aU3jTfx9j4NCpaAFbvVt6sTNAuLTpfT
transaction
5824bc7e50bb304f913fca6e28acf6073c87f05b53cd261d7f9ca0d5bba77e78
confirmations
639116
spent
true